Output 062c84702ae21c81da8305eb4fcf86366203b1c03a2f398513342de03739b64c: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3b4302bda5c00d289d81159aab9759f4863127 OP_EQUAL
address
34GHqVd8f1XiE15egeSYh8sxaGvM1dE1Y9
transaction
062c84702ae21c81da8305eb4fcf86366203b1c03a2f398513342de03739b64c
confirmations
331937
spent
true